Air Fryer Panko Cod

5 from 1 vote
Prep Time: 15 minutes
Cook Time: 10 minutes
Total Time: 25 minutes
Servings: 4 Servings

Description

This Air Fryer Panko Cod recipe is a quick and easy family dinner recipe that the whole family will love! The cod has a tasty and crispy panko coating , perfect for a quick meal.

Ingredients 

  • 4 Cod Fillets, Thawed and pat dry if previously frozen
  • 1 Large Egg
  • ½ Cup All-Purpose Flour
  • 1 cup Panko Bread Crumbs
  • 1 tsp Paprika
  • ½ teaspoon Cayenne Pepper, Optional
  • 1 teaspoon Garlic Powder
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• ½ teaspoon Ground Black Pepper

Instructions

  • Season both sides of the cod fillets with salt and pepper to taste.
  • In a shallow dish, place the all-purpose flour. In a second dish, beat the eggs. In a third dish, combine the panko breadcrumbs with paprika and garlic powder, mixing well.
  • Lightly coat each cod fillet in flour, shaking off any excess. Dip next into the beaten eggs, allowing the excess to drip off. Finally, press the fillet into the panko mixture, ensuring it's well-coated on all sides.
  • Preheat your air fryer to 400°F (200°C). This step ensures a quick and even cooking process.
  • Lightly spray the air fryer basket with cooking spray to prevent sticking. Place the breaded cod fillets in the basket, making sure they don't touch to allow for proper air circulation. Spray the tops of the fillets lightly with cooking spray to help achieve a golden color.
  • Air fry the cod for about 10-12 minutes, or until the coating is golden brown and crispy, and the fish flakes easily with a fork. There’s no need to flip the fillets during cooking, but you can if you desire an even crispier coating.
  • Carefully remove the panko-crusted cod from the air fryer. Let it rest for a couple of minutes before serving to allow the juices to redistribute.
  • Serve your Panko-Crusted Cod hot, accompanied by your favorite sides, such as a light salad, steamed vegetables, or tartar sauce and lemon wedges for an added zest.

Notes

All air fryers are different. I used the Cosori Air fryer for this recipe. You can select the seafood setting and adjust the timing. You may have to adjust time and temperature if you have a different model.
